Job Description

Mechanical Engineer Equiliem medical insurance, dental insurance, life insurance, 401(k) United States, Wisconsin, Madison May 20, 2026 Mechanical Engineer Madison, WI
Pay:
$58.26 - $63.00 per hour 26-05047 Job Summary The Mechanical Engineer is responsible for supporting sustaining engineering activities related to product improvements, change control management, verification testing, and manufacturing support within a regulated environment. This role involves executing engineering changes, updating CAD models and drawings, supporting validation and verification activities, troubleshooting manufacturing and equipment issues, and collaborating with cross-functional teams to ensure product quality, compliance, and operational efficiency. The ideal candidate has strong mechanical design experience, analytical problem-solving abilities, and experience working within medical device or other regulated manufacturing environments. Job Responsibilities Manage and execute change controls from initiation through final closeout using document control systems Create and revise CAD models and engineering drawings using SolidWorks for continuous improvement initiatives Support design updates involving machined metal, plastic, and sheet metal components Develop, execute, and document verification and validation activities including protocols, testing, and final reports Route and maintain engineering documentation in compliance with SOPs, traceability requirements, and approval workflows Perform part measurements, tolerance analysis, and statistical analysis to support engineering changes and assembly stack-up evaluations Support manufacturing operations by troubleshooting production issues and collaborating with Operations and Quality teams to implement corrective actions Support design and maintenance of mechanical enclosures and test system components Read and interpret schematics, drawings, and technical documentation to support fixture design and troubleshooting efforts Specify, source, and build test fixtures and related mechanical assemblies Identify root causes of mechanical and process issues and implement corrective actions Ensure compliance with regulatory requirements, safety standards, GDP, and GMP practices Collaborate with engineers, technicians, and cross-functional teams to coordinate engineering projects and support activities Maintain accurate technical records and engineering documentation Provide technical guidance and support to team members and manufacturing personnel Estimate labor and material requirements for engineering projects and repair activities Follow all safety procedures and maintain a safe working environment Support sustaining and continuous improvement initiatives within the manufacturing environment Job Requirements Bachelor's degree in Mechanical Engineering or related engineering discipline required Minimum of 5-10 years of related engineering experience required Strong experience using SolidWorks for CAD design and engineering drawing revisions Experience managing engineering change controls and documentation systems Knowledge of verification and validation processes within regulated environments Ability to perform tolerance analysis, measurements, and statistical evaluations Ability to read and interpret engineering drawings, schematics, and technical documentation Strong troubleshooting and root cause analysis skills Experience supporting small to medium-sized continuous improvement projects preferred Strong organizational, communication, and multitasking abilities Ability to work effectively within a collaborative team environment Ability to adapt and reprioritize tasks to support manufacturing floor needs Familiarity with GMP, GDP, and regulated manufacturing environments preferred Strong attention to detail and documentation accuracy Work Experience Previous experience in sustaining engineering, manufacturing engineering, or mechanical engineering required Medical device or other regulated industry experience preferred Experience supporting manufacturing operations and continuous improvement initiatives preferred Experience with GD&T and project management activities is a plus Familiarity with Windows-based test systems preferred #ZR About Equiliem Equiliem believes in empowering success.
